发动机冷却液温度模糊控制系统的研究

Study of Fuzzy Control System for Engine Coolant Temperature

  • 摘要: 提出了发动机冷却液温度的模糊控制方法,将冷却液温度进行模糊化,根据实验建立了相应的模糊控制规则库;应用MATLAB软件的模糊逻辑工具,计算分析得到了控制查询表,建立了以Motorola单片机MC68HC908LJ12为核心的硬件系统,并对软件进行了设计。试验表明,该方法只需对现有的发动机冷却系统进行较少的改进,便可较好地解决发动机的冷却液温度难于准确控制的问题。

     

    Abstract: A fuzzy method for controlling the engine coolant temperature is prposed. The fuzzy rule base is correspondingly established based on the experimental data. The control query table is created through computing and analyzing via the fuzzy logic tools in MATLAB. The hardware system, centering on MC68HC908LJ12, is conducted. The software is designed as well. The test indicates that only a little improvement of the current engine cooling system can better solve the problem that it is difficult to accurately control the engine coolant temperature.
